Cost of Living Comparison Between Skopje and TorreonCost of Living Comparison Between Skopje and Torreon
Monthly Cost of Living
😐A single person spends $1,112 per month in Skopje vs $832 in Torreon,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$1,621 per month in Skopje vs $1,376 in Torreon,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$2,130 per month in Skopje vs $1,920 in Torreon, rent included.
😐Skopje costs about 34% more than Torreon,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.
📊Both Skopje and Torreon are more affordable than the global median – Skopje17% lower, Torreon38%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$429 in Skopje versus $265 in Torreon.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 13% higher in Skopje,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$34.00 in Skopje versus $43.00 in Torreon.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$213 vs $245 – making Skopje the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
